Biography

Mark Normand is an American comedian and actor. He started doing stand-up comedy in his hometown of New Orleans in 2006.

Mark has performed in various places across the United States and even internationally. He's been a guest on popular talk shows like Conan, The Tonight Show with Jimmy Fallon, and The Late Show with Stephen Colbert.

Notably, Normand co-hosts a podcast called Tuesdays with Stories with his comedian friend Joe List since 2013. He also co-hosts another podcast called We Might be Drunk with comedian Sam Morril.

Mark Normand is originally from New Orleans, where he went to De La Salle High School. He briefly studied at the New York Film Academy before deciding to leave.

In a 2023 podcast interview with Neal Brennan, Normand mentioned that he had also attended Louisiana State University and Baton Rouge Community College before graduating from Southeastern Louisiana University.

Career

Mark Normand started doing stand-up comedy in 2006 at Lucy's Retired Surfer Bar in New Orleans.

Since then, he has performed at comedy clubs and colleges all over the country and appeared at various festivals, including the Bridgetown Comedy Festival, Seattle International Comedy Competition, Boston Comedy Festival, and the Melbourne International Comedy Festival. In 2013, he was featured as a New Face at Just for Laughs in Montreal.

Mark Normand's comedy career includes a half-hour special on Comedy Central's The Half Hour in 2014 and an album titled Still Got It with Comedy Central Records, recorded in Madison, Wisconsin, in the same year. In 2017, he released a one-hour Comedy Central special called Don't Be Yourself.

He has made appearances on popular TV shows like Conan, The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on, The Late Show with Stephen Colbert, The Late Late Show with James Corden, TruTv, Best Week Ever, MTV, Last Comic Standing, and @midnight. Mark Normand also had roles in Inside Amy Schumer and Horace and Pete.

In 2013, he won Carolines on Broadway's March Madness competition and was named Best Comedian of 2013 by The Village Voice.

In 2012, he appeared on John Oliver's New York Stand-Up Show on Comedy Central, and in 2011, he was selected as one of Comedy Central's Comics to Watch for the 2011 New York Comedy Festival.

He also received recognition as Esquire's Best New Comedians 2012 and Time Out New York's 21 New York Comedy Scene Linchpins.
